Mather has a population of 711, which is below the state average. This suggests a smaller and more localized community environment.
The median household income in Mather is $42,118, which is below the state average, indicating moderate economic conditions.
The average housing price in Mather is about $92,118, making it relatively affordable compared to many cities in Pennsylvania.
The unemployment rate in Mather is 6.11%, slightly above the state average, suggesting moderate employment conditions. Mather has a lower crime rate than the state average, contributing to a relatively safer living environment.
